A 29-year-old using DMPA for 2 years plans pregnancy next year and asks when fertility returns after stopping. She has regular injections and no other medical problems. What would you advise this patient?

Correct answer: EReturn of fertility may be delayed for up to 1 year

DMPA is associated with a delay in return to fertility, which can be up to about 1 year. This is a delay, not permanent infertility. POP, implant and intrauterine methods have more rapid return of fertility after discontinuation.
